Will the new CA certificates be included in any other patch (e.g. 3.0.y)
with automatic update
I think that's what's going to happen as far as I could see, but it
might take a while. I'm not sure if it's already checked in into this
branch.
Nelson has proposed adding the new roots and the EV changes to the 3.0.x
branch, and the Firefox developers seem to agree that that would be a
good idea. To my knowledge the changes have not yet been checked in, and
there is not yet a bug in Bugzilla to track this.
Speaking personally I think it is highly probable that a future 3.0.x
release will have the new roots and the EV changes. However because
3.0.x releases can be released quite suddenly in cases where there is a
significant security vulnerability, there is no guarantee that the root
and EV changes will be in the very next 3.0.x release (3.0.11, I believe).
